Abstract
The utility model discloses a kind of vibrating diaphragm, it includes vibration section, the fixed part extended from the outwardly extending ring portion of the periphery of the vibration section, from the ring portion to the direction far from the vibration section and the top dome for being fixed on the vibration section, the vibrating diaphragm further includes the supporting element for being fixed on the vibration section, the top dome is fixed on the vibration section by the supports support and the top dome and the vibration section interval is arranged, and the top dome at least partly covers the ring portion.Originally practical that a kind of microphone device with the vibrating diaphragm is also provided.Compared with the relevant technologies, the microphone device high-frequency acoustic performance of the vibrating diaphragm and utilization of the utility model vibrating diaphragm is more preferable.

Simultaneously refering to fig. 1-2, the utility model provides a kind of vibrating diaphragm 100 comprising vibration section 1, by the vibration section 1
The outwardly extending ring portion 2 of periphery, is fixed the fixed part 3 extended from the ring portion 2 to the direction far from the vibration section 1
Top dome 4 and supporting element 5 in the vibration section 1.
The supporting element 5 is fixed on the vibration section 1, and the top dome 4 is fixed on the supporting element 5, the top dome 4
It is fixed on the vibration section 1 by the supporting element 5 support and is spaced with the vibration section 1 and be arranged, the top dome 4 is at least partly
Cover the ring portion 2.The entire area for increasing the top dome 4 of the structure setting high degree, can effectively promote its vibration
Dynamic high frequency performance, and avoid the interference of the top dome 4 and the ring portion 2, good reliability.More preferably, the top dome 4 is complete
Ring portion 2 described in all standing.
In present embodiment, the supporting element 5 can be fixed on the vibration section 1 by glued mode, the top dome 4
It can also be fixed on by glued mode on the supporting element 5, other fixed forms, such as supersonic welding can also be passed through certainly
It connects.
In present embodiment, the arc-shaped structure of the top dome 4 and the ring portion 2.More preferably, the arc-shaped recess of the two
Direction is identical.
In present embodiment, the supporting element 5 is cyclic structure.The fixed top dome 4 not only can be effectively supported as a result, but also
Material cost can be saved.Certain supporting element 5 can be with other structures such as solid blocks, to realize that the support to top dome 4 is solid
Determine and the top dome 4 is kept to be arranged with the vibration section 1 interval.
In conjunction with ginseng Fig. 3-4, the utility model also provides a kind of microphone device 200 comprising frame 10 is fixed on the basin
The vibrational system 20 of frame 10 and the magnetic circuit system 30 for driving 20 vibration sounding of vibrational system.The vibrational system 20 includes this
The above-mentioned vibrating diaphragm 100 that utility model provides.
The fixed part 3 of the vibrating diaphragm 100 is fixed on the frame 10, to the vibrating diaphragm 100 be overally supported solid
Due to the frame 10.The top dome 4 is located at the side far from the magnetic circuit system 30 of the vibration section 1.
Specifically, the top dome 4 is in the arcuate structure being recessed far from 30 direction of magnetic circuit system, the ring portion 2
In the arcuate structure being recessed to separate 30 direction of magnetic circuit system.One side arcuate structure design so that the ring portion 2 more
The oscillation intensity of the excellent improvement vibration section 1, improves vibration sounding performance;On the other hand, the top dome 4 of arcuate structure is more
The area for increasing the top dome 4 of big degree, effectively improves the high frequency performance of the microphone device 200, improves described
The high frequency directive property and expansion audition range of microphone device 200.
